EMC Testing Standards
EMC Testing Standards
There are lots of electromagnetic compatibility (EMC) testing standards worldwide. In countries who apply CE marking regulations, EMC testing standards are mostly based on EMC Directive 2014/30/EU and harmonised standards under this directive.
Harmonised standards under EMC Directive 2014/30/EU are listed on European Commission’s web page and Official Journal.
You can see a list of EMC testing standards listed as harmonised standards of EMC Directive 2014/30/EU. The list shows the standards on 23 January 2019. Recent version is on the link provided below this list.

(1) ESO: European standardisation organisation:
CEN: Rue de la Science 23, B-1040 Brussels, Phone: +32 2 550 08 11; Fax: +32 2 550 08 19 (http://www.cen.eu)
CENELEC: Rue de la Science 23, B-1040 Brussels, Phone: +32 2 550 08 11; Fax: +32 2 550 08 19 (http://www.cenelec.eu)
ETSI: 650, route des Lucioles, F-06921 Sophia Antipolis, Tel.+33 492 944200; fax +33 493 654716, (http://www.etsi.eu)
Note 1: Generally the date of cessation of presumption of conformity will be the date of withdrawal (“dow”), set by the European standardisation organisation, but attention of users of these standards is drawn to the fact that in certain exceptional cases this can be otherwise.
Note 2.1: The new (or amended) standard has the same scope as the superseded standard. On the date stated, the superseded standard ceases to give presumption of conformity with the essential or other requirements of the relevant Union legislation.
Note 2.2: The new standard has a broader scope than the superseded standard. On the date stated the superseded standard ceases to give presumption of conformity with the essential or other requirements of the relevant Union legislation.
Note 2.3: The new standard has a narrower scope than the superseded standard. On the date stated the (partially) superseded standard ceases to give presumption of conformity with the essential or other requirements of the relevant Union legislation for those products or services that fall within the scope of the new standard. Presumption of conformity with the essential or other requirements of the relevant Union legislation for products or services that still fall within the scope of the (partially) superseded standard, but that do not fall within the scope of the new standard, is unaffected.
Note 3: In case of amendments, the referenced standard is EN CCCCC:YYYY, its previous amendments, if any, and the new, quoted amendment. The superseded standard therefore consists of EN CCCCC:YYYY and its previous amendments, if any, but without the new quoted amendment. On the date stated, the superseded standard ceases to give presumption of conformity with the essential or other requirements of the relevant Union legislation.

What is FCC Certificate?
What is FCC?
The Federal Communications Commission (FCC) is an independent government agency that oversees American interstate and international radio, television, telephone, satellite and cable communications. Regarding the use and function of electronic devices, this organization organizes a wide range of tests and sets out the rules for products sold and used in the United States. The FCC requires the manufacturer to ensure that all customer-oriented telecom products and network-related telecom devices meet the minimum standard compliance.

EMC Testing Labs
What is EMC Testing Labs?
Electromagnetic Compatibility (EMC) is a laboratory consisting of special room and test equipment according to the standards.
How many different EMC Test Lab types are there?
The characteristics or scopes of EMC testing laboratories depend on the product to be tested, the product specifications, the laboratory infrastructure and the test equipment used.
– The laboratory infrastructure and test equipment are divided into international (IEC, CISPR, ANSI …) standards according to whether they are:
Pre-Compliance EMC Test Laboratories:
This type of product developers, designers, manufacturers or universities in this type of EMC laboratories for R & D purposes in the EMC tests are carried out to ensure that the product tested before the full compliance of the tested.This type of EMC labs can be installed and operated at a more affordable cost since the standards are not in full compliance.
Full Compliance EMC Laboratories:
Using EMC testing laboratories and test rooms in accordance with international standards, EMC testing laboratories can provide independent and impartial services, and measurement results and test reports are accepted internationally.Such laboratories can be authorized by authorized accreditation bodies (TÜRKAK, UKAS, DAkkS …).

How to build EMC Laboratories
First of all, technical specifications (maximum voltage, current, power, port numbers, weights and dimensions) and usage areas (home, similar, industry, medical, automotive, defense) should be determined. Since the EMC Test Laboratory to be established will be directly connected to the above properties of the product to be tested technically, the cost of the laboratory will be determined by the above parameters.
After determining the properties and usage areas of the products to be tested, the standards to be applied are determined.
Test laboratory infrastructure (anechoic chamber, screened room, electrical / water system installation, building construction) and EMC test equipment are determined according to the standards to be applied. A list of infrastructure and materials is provided according to the intended use of the EMC test laboratory.
